    Open Mind, thanks for your comments and concerns.

    Item 1: Barbara has an entire section in her book, entitled, "The Three Year Rule". It runs from pages 33 to 38 and makes the following citations, with quotations:

    Organization Book, version 1972, page 170, paragraph 2 (if a man had committed a "serious wrong" but two or three years had passed and he seemed to have Jehovah’s blessing and the esteem of the congregation, he could remain in his position, or be appointed.)

    October 72 KM Question Box (OR book reiterated and clarified)

    November 1991 KM School (72 KM policy reiterated)

    1995 WT outline for CO meeting with BOE

    Letter from Red Bluff North Congregation, CA to Service Dept, where this policy is referred to

    1994 Letter from D.O. Donald Amy to Service Dept. which suggests changing this "three year rule" policy regarding a case of pedophilia (which remained unchanged at least until 2000)

    Major lawsuits were filed in 2003. At the 2005 KM School the policy officially changed.
